To celebrate New York Fashion Week, creator of KidSuper, Colm Dillane discusses straddling the line between streetwear and wearable art.
About this Event

To mark New York Fashion Week, Colm Dillane joins Rizzoli Bookstore for a conversation about creativity, curiosity, and the making of KidSuper.

Dillane will discuss his newly released book, an illustrated autobiography that traces his path from a dorm room at NYU to one of fashion’s most unexpected and expansive creative practices. Less a traditional memoir than a visual notebook, the book moves through clothing, painting, performance, and collaboration, capturing the spirit of a designer who has never been interested in staying in one lane. Dillane will be in conversation with Josh Baer, followed by a book signing.

Born and raised in Manhattan, Dillane founded KidSuper as a way to hold everything he makes under one roof. What began as graphic T-shirts sold to friends quickly grew into a Brooklyn-based studio where fashion exists alongside paintings, films, music, and live performances. The clothes reflect that mindset. Bold, tactile, and playful, they sit somewhere between streetwear and wearable art, driven by emotion rather than trend.

Collaboration has always been central to Dillane’s practice. His runway shows feel closer to cultural gatherings than traditional fashion presentations, often featuring artists, athletes, and performers from across disciplines, from Action Bronson to Tyra Banks to Ronaldinho to Vincent Cassel. Each show builds a world, soundtracked and staged with the same care as the clothes themselves.

That open, multidisciplinary approach has brought Dillane recognition well beyond New York. In 2023, he was invited to guest design the Louis Vuitton Homme Collection, a rare moment that underscored his position as a true outsider operating at the highest level. The book brings together the artwork, graphics, and ideas behind those moments, offering a glimpse into the restless energy and joy that sit at the center of KidSuper.

More than a retrospective, the conversation at Rizzoli is an invitation into Dillane’s way of thinking: playful, sincere, and rooted in the belief that creativity works best when it stays open.

Colm Dillane’s path to fashion wasn’t linear - and that’s part of what makes it so compelling. Before launching KidSuper, he played professional football, made short films, recorded music, and painted. The label grew out of that same restless energy: a natural extension of a creative practice that never fit neatly into a single box. What began as a way to screenprint T-shirts for friends has evolved into a platform that bridges fashion, art, and storytelling—with a healthy dose of humor along the way.

In 2020, after two rejections, Dillane finally made it onto the official Paris Fashion Week calendar - not with a traditional runway, but with a claymation film that felt more like a wildly imaginative experiment than a debut. It was strange, funny, and surprisingly moving, and the industry took notice. A year later, Dillane became the first American to win the LVMH Karl Lagerfeld Prize, an acknowledgment not just of talent but of vision.

KidSuper is part clothing label, part art project, part social experiment. And Dillane is its magnetic center. Born in New York to an Irish fisherman and a Spanish painter, he grew up between cultures and disciplines, absorbing as much from the classroom as from the soccer field or his mother’s studio. That duality - playful yet precise, scrappy but soulful - is baked into everything he touches.

Calling KidSuper’s collections “collections” doesn’t quite capture what Dillane puts on a runway. Each season feels more like an open letter - sometimes to New York, sometimes to his friends, always to the chaotic, endearing parts of being alive. In an industry that often prizes polish and distance, he leans into vulnerability, humor, and a kind of joyful disorder. His shows land somewhere between performance and provocation: part theater, part reflection. They’ve become a fixture on the Paris Fashion Week schedule not for chasing the moment, but for offering something entirely of their own.

Josh Baer is a leading arts writer, advisor, and the founder and CEO of The Baer Faxt, a multi-channel digital content platform that has held an unrivaled position at the nexus of the art world for over 30 years. He is known for sharing his art world insights to a global audience of art market professionals each week via The Baer Faxt Newsletter, Podcast, and proprietary Auction Database. Last fall, The Baer Faxt expanded its mission and launched No Reserve, a fast-growing, free weekly newsletter designed to address the needs of new and aspiring collectors across multiple art and luxury categories.

In his long-running art advisory practice, Josh is known in the industry for helping clients to avoid costly mistakes. With a strong track record of art acquisitions and successful sales, he works with some of the industry’s most influential collectors, and has completed over $500 million worth of transactions to date.
